Русификация для WordPress плагина OpenID версии 3.*
или
Сам плагин качать
Затем скачиваем мой русификатор и распаковываем файлы из архива в wp-content/plugins/openid/lang/ (про соблюдение регистра букв в именах файлов не забываем)
У себя я его еще не до конца поборол (плагин XRDS поставил таки и он работает) и на форуме (по первой ссылке) там описаны похожие баги с созданием новых юзеров в wp2.6.2 и белым экраном после авторизации (используя урл блога как сервер). пишут про конфликты с bad behavior и еще чем то.
Если есть опыт решения проблем с ним – пишите в коменты. Конкретно интересует и «белый экран» после логина с использованием адреса блога в качестве Openid когда пишу коменты на других блогах (урл при этом такой lecactus.ru/?openid_server=1)
Связанные записи
39 комментариев
Трэкбеки и пингбеки
Комментарии не по теме удаляются! Читайте реадми дистрибутива, комментарии выше и FAQ! Прежде чем задавать вопрос, прочитайте это. Научитесь ценить чужое время!

(голосов: 7, средний: 4.57 из 5)

20 октября 2008 в 3:01 (GMT+6)
Спасибо за русификацию..! Очень пригодилась..
31 октября 2008 в 6:02 (GMT+6)
У меня все чики пуки работает, кстати с прошедшим днем варения! Любви здоровья, бабла и душевного равновесия =)
13 ноября 2008 в 22:00 (GMT+6)
Рияегистрация/логин по OId работет, а вот из формы комментирования не постит, если предварительно не залогиниться. Кстати сейчас проверим, как с этим у вас… у вас просит заполнить имя и почту… я поставил в настройках плагина, что это не обязательно, но пока в настройках самого вордпресса не отключишь, все равно спрашивает имя и мыло… галочку сняли, ничего не спрашивает, но и коммент не постит… что не так?
25 ноября 2008 в 3:55 (GMT+6)
test open id сервера, извини что тебя выбрал в качестве тренировочной кошки! =)
25 ноября 2008 в 9:32 (GMT+6)
а какого именно? того плагина xrds что идет с плагином или другого? xrds у меня упорно не хочет работать. после авторизации белый экран
27 ноября 2008 в 2:37 (GMT+6)
У меня этот самый косяк с OpenID. Белый экран, дублирование имен юзеров и переход по адресу типа
Пошел искать решение проблемы.
30 ноября 2008 в 0:04 (GMT+6)
обновил перевод (до версии плагина 3.1.4)
16 декабря 2008 в 1:56 (GMT+6)
Не работает. Пишет
Fatal error: Call to undefined function add_options_page() in /home/201328/http/wp-content/plugins/wp-contact-form/wp-contactform.php on line 200
WP 2.7, XRDS-Simple 1.0, OpenID 3.1.4, WP-ContactForm 3.1.8
16 декабря 2008 в 1:58 (GMT+6)
Сергей, ругается
на ваш плагин контактной форму. ищите баг там
16 декабря 2008 в 19:05 (GMT+6)
Постоянно эти проблемы с опенид плагином…
Причём постоянно разные.
То, что он у вас порезал текст комментария – вообще чудовищно.
Поскольку мне нужен openid только для комментирования (только сервер), видимо, снесу его нафиг и поставлю openid редирект с каким-нибудь нормальным провайдером.
На днях, кстати, интергрировала phpMyID с вопрдпрессом… Получилось.
После чего поняла, что phpMyID не работает с половиной openid клиентов…
Ужас, ни одного нормального скрипта-провайдера.
16 декабря 2008 в 19:07 (GMT+6)
эти проблемы с опенид плагином…
попробуйте перезапостить мой длинный комент сюда. посмотрим у меня глючит или нет ;-)
17 декабря 2008 в 18:23 (GMT+6)
Отличная идея, пробую.
родной аськин клиент тоже кстати постоянно подкладывает свинью своим родным пользователям (я сам не пользуюсь, но на работе часть юзеров на ней сидит). один раз кинули их заблокировав 5.0.1 кажется и заставив перейти на 5.1, затем блокировали 5.1 и заставили ставить 6.0. потом заблокировали 6.0 и выпустили “обновленную 6.0″. после этого заставили перейти их на 6.5.
И все это при уебищном инсталляторе и огромном дистрибутиве по сравнению с “альтернативными клиентами”. Пользовался мирандой с 2001 по 2005 год .потом кстати тоже один раз она заблокировалась и потребовала “обновление протокола”. ставил новые версии но все не то – если старую версию юзал отточенную и настроенную как надо, то новые версии все сплошь глючные пошли что пустые, что чужие модификации (которые вообще ахтунг как глючат). В итоге плюнул и пересел на QIP а затем на INFIUM использую стандартный скин из комплекта, настроил основыне протоколы по которым общаюсь и стер с компа остальные родные клиенты. Да, он тоже не идеален – любит иногда зависнуть на ровном месте или выдать ошибку при закрыти, но пользоваться им приятно. на работе 95% юзеров пересели с миранды и родного клиента тоже на qip и qip infium.
Оставшиеся 5% юзают родной клиент аськи принципиально. самое смешное что icq2003b с древнючим протоколом работала, работает и ни разу за последние 5 лет не выдавала “обновите вашего клиента”. ей тоже пользуются на работе некоторые “консерваторы”. Пусть она тормозная, размер базы у нее мегабайтами меряется(даже десятками), но нравится им.
17 декабря 2008 в 18:23 (GMT+6)
jehy, комент прошел
17 декабря 2008 в 18:28 (GMT+6)
Странно как.
Что-то, что цепляется на урл, и при это режет комменты…
*Сейчас попробовал попостить это же у себя с левым опенид – работает
*А теперь – со своим опенид – всё равно работает…
Чертовщина какая-то ))
25 декабря 2008 в 1:17 (GMT+6)
извиняюсь – у самого этот плагин не работает должным образом, решил проверить у Вас :)
28 декабря 2008 в 8:27 (GMT+6)
У меня тоже был белый экран на странице /?openid_server=1. После включения отображения ошибок на сервере, стала отображаться ошибка:
Fatal error: Call to a member function needsSigning() on a non-object in ////www/stranstvie.com/wp-content/plugins/openid/Auth/OpenID/Server.php on line 1495
28 декабря 2008 в 8:29 (GMT+6)
комментарий обрезался:
…
Если погуглить, то можно увидеть, что такая ошибка на многих блогах вылезает.
22 февраля 2009 в 5:34 (GMT+6)
Решил занятся модернизацией своего блога и руки дошли до OpenID. Буду крайне благодарен за помощь по такому вопросу… как установить и заставить работать это дивный OpenID плагин? Если точнее, как установить форму для ввода идентификатора, так, например, как это сделано тут.
22 февраля 2009 в 10:45 (GMT+6)
Эдуардд Отечественный, 1 прочитайте правила мои. 2 достаточно изучить исходный код страницы чтобы понять что и с чем едят
22 февраля 2009 в 17:29 (GMT+6)
Да уж, правила, они правила и есть. Я, собственно, уже и правила, и код изучил, но найти там ответ на свой вопрос не сумел. Пытался использовать отличный (во всяком случае его функциональность меня вполне устраивала) плагин OpenID Comments for WordPress, но а) он отказался работать на новой версии ВП; б) он старый и не поддерживается. А с оригинальным OpenID-плагином я совершенно не сдружился.
Весь этот механизм нужен только для комментирования, поэтому, если позволите, вопрос в лоб. В ридми в плагину есть вопрос: "How do I add an OpenID field to my comment form?" и в ответе на него приводится кусочек кода для добавления поля опенид в форму комментирования. Это и есть вся премудрость настройки данного плагина?
22 февраля 2009 в 17:40 (GMT+6)
могу сказать так – то что там написано в реадми не всем подходит и не для каждой темы. если посмотрите в код страницы у меня то увидите что там не совсем так как предлагается. когда я делал так как в реадми у меня либо не работало вообще либо выдавало лишнюю страницу для подтверждения.
23 февраля 2009 в 0:00 (GMT+6)
Тьфу-тьфу-тьфу, но вроде бы всё получилось. Немного всё-таки помучался, но теперь вроде бы работает всё. Тогда ещё один квесчен и я думаю, что моя проблема будет исчерпана окончательно. В плагине OpenID действительно так немного настроек (раздел OpenID в Настройках с настройками получателя и провайдера) или я что-то пропустил?
23 февраля 2009 в 0:06 (GMT+6)
Эдуард Отечественный, в разделе пользователей в админке еще заглядывали?
23 февраля 2009 в 1:32 (GMT+6)
Да, но там же можно только связать OpenID с аккаунтом, а настроек особо и нет никаких
23 февраля 2009 в 1:33 (GMT+6)
Эдуард Отечественный, а они нужны? чем меньше тем лучше
23 февраля 2009 в 2:11 (GMT+6)
Меня видимо "разбаловали" плагины наподобии Simple Tags или Akismet, у которых немеряно разных финтифлюшечек, некоторые из которых ещё и "разбросаны" по админке
23 февраля 2009 в 23:39 (GMT+6)
Спасибо, за поддержку "зелёному" блоггеру. OpenID настроил, убрал проверку имени и пароля (хотя если вводить имя, то отображается симпатичнее) – полёт проходит нормально. Прикрутил (вот этим: LiveJournal Userpics) аватарки для ЖЖ юзеров, так что на пока всё вроде бы неплохо. Чуть позже разберусь с граватарами – как-то никогда с ними не работал. Ещё раз благодарю за понимание.
16 марта 2009 в 21:35 (GMT+6)
У меня плагин рабоитать все равно не хочет. Я вроде могу авторизироваться и коментить по своему OpenID. А вот у меня юзеры не могут :(
13 мая 2009 в 11:31 (GMT+6)
Сам столкнулся с такой проблемой на вп 3.0. пока побороть не получается, комментарии удается отправить только если вручную вбил разрешение на сайт в опенид админке. Если удалось как-то решить – маякните.
18 января 2010 в 16:58 (GMT+6)
Спасибо за перевод
18 апреля 2010 в 17:31 (GMT+6)
Спасибо :)
10 июня 2010 в 11:07 (GMT+6)
Спасибо! Настроил (правда пока лишь в качестве сервера, но это и требовалось), пока полет нормальный =)
29 августа 2010 в 14:02 (GMT+6)
Выдает вот такую ошибку Fatal error: Allowed memory size of 67108864 bytes exhausted (tried to allocate 7680 bytes) in что делать ?
19 января 2011 в 16:55 (GMT+6)
Чтобы не было ошибки Call to a member function needsSigning()
нужно вырубить плагины использующие session_start() в неправильных местах, цитата:
The problem is NOT with the OpenID plug-in, it’s with other plug-ins which start a session in irregular places. It’s a bad programming practice to start the session outside of a function where it will be invoked on every page load irrespective of whether or not the actual plug-in code is triggered. Plus, as we have seen, plug-ins which behave like that don’t play well with other plug-ins that are also dependent upon the session. From a programming standpoint, the “bug” is in the ill-behaved plug-in and not in the OpenID plug-in. There isn’t any way to code around it; the issue must be fixed at the source.
11 марта 2011 в 1:52 (GMT+6)
и что?
30 марта 2012 в 21:43 (GMT+6)
На данный момент думаю самое удобное использовать Яндекс как сервер и просто прописать дополнительные мета теги на сайте.